Saving Games Journalism With Giant Bomb

In this episode, Ed Zitron is joined by Dan Ryckert, Jeff Bakalar and Jeff Grubb, the new owners of gaming website Giant Bomb, to talk about the hopeful, independent future for games journalism - and media at large.
